Common reasons for wearing compression stockings:

  • History of blood clots or dvts (deep vein thrombosis)
  • Varicose veins, venous insufficiency, Edema, and orthostatic hypotension
  • Leg injury or surgery
  • Increased body weight (pregnancy, obesity)
  • Standing or sitting for prolonged periods without walking (long distance travels, flying)
  • Diabetes
  • Lymphedema
  • Natural Aging
